The sun’s rays shimmered through the library windows and touched upon the golden locks of the young Queen sitting at a desk. Piles of paper stacked high on the right side and on the left boxes of neat papers inside of the ones she reviewed and stamped. It had been a long week of nothing but sitting in front of the desk making sure new recruits were filed, castle security and infractures, and keeping tabs on the treasury income. She hated having to do this but if she wanted to learn how to manage things she would have to take it upon herself to learn the experience of work. Leaning back against the chair, Freyleif stretched out her legs and arms before rubbing her tired eyes. One of the librarians came up and demanded she take a rest and took it upon himself to finish the paperwork; after all, the Queen was soon to have children.
“Your health is more important, let me take it from here. Please, your Majesty, don’t over stress.” the man said calmly in speaking her native tongue.
Her back was hurting like a bitch and replied, “Fine, fine, fine just make sure to report everything to me once you’re done.” she stood up with a yawn.
“Of course!” the man quickly took to the seat and was right to work after the Queen moved away from the desk. It was nice to have such caring and reliable Quincy in her stead.
As she walked through the short hall to the entrance to get some fresh air, Freyleif wondered how Aodh and Ame were doing on their trip to Egypt. Hopefully, they didn’t run into too much trouble with the locals or worse: eaten by a hollow with the nasty plague rumors. She just had to trust her Sternritters for the time being and not get so worked up losing her friends. Putting those worrying thoughts aside the young Queen headed out towards the front entrance of the castle and traveled down the road to admire the trees; though she wished to be back in her hometown, but she decided to stay in Germany and take over Weylin's castle in respects of taking care of the place and hearing the rumours that Germany was the place of origin for Quincy before spreading out their arts and bloodline.
It was nice to get out with the clear weather, the smell of forestry surrounding the castle, and birds chirping in the birdbath in the garden she walked past. Today seemed peaceful enough to just relax and stretch out her legs even breathe in the fresh morning air. She found a random patch of grass to lay out on the road just a few ways from the castle and decided to get her feet free from the confines of her knee high black boots and removed her fur-trimmed mantle then folded it up to lay her head on.
Lacing her fingers behind her head, the Queen closed her eyes and let the sound of nature help her drift off to a restful sleep. Well until something in the back of her mind aroused her back awake. Not far ahead she picked up the signature of another coming close up the road and slowly opened one eye then the other lazily. She lifted her head up just enough to peek at the signature heading her way as she laid out near the curve; one might easily spot her snuggled by the trees with the sun giving spotlight. Groaning in the effort, the lil Queen pushed herself upright and watched the figure, now man, coming into sight and waved him over with a grin upon her lips and no guards watching her.
